Released December 24th, 2008, 'The Class' stars François Bégaudeau, Arthur Fogel, Damien Gomes, Esmeralda Ouertani The PG-13 movie has a runtime of about 2 hr 8 min, and received a user score of 70 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 675 respected users.
You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"Teacher and novelist François Bégaudeau plays a version of himself as he negotiates a year with his racially mixed students from a tough Parisian neighborhood."
